Softball Recap: Hillsboro Burros vs. Antioch Bears
Hillsboro extended their losing streak to four on Tuesday, dropping their season record down to 2-7 in the process. They came up short against the Antioch Bears, falling 20-4.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against the Bears this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 6-3 last Tuesday.
As for Antioch, the win was the fourth in a row for them, bringing their record up to 13-6. They might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team has won 12 matches by seven runs or more this season.
For Antioch's part, Maliyah Perry made a splash no matter where she played. She didn't allow a single earned run and allowed only two hits over four innings pitched. Perry was also big at the plate, getting on base in three of her four plate appearances with two stolen bases, two runs, and one double.
In other batting news, Chiari Batey was incredible, going a perfect 4-for-4 with eight RBI, three runs, and two doubles. That's the most hits she has posted over her last ten games. Alaina Givens was another key player, going a perfect 2-for-2 with three runs, two RBI, and one double.
